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ary terms help clarify concepts commonly encountered in commercial real estate deals.

Property Title and Ownership

Legal title to a property and the chain of ownership; due diligence checks confirm clear title and identify liens or encumbrances.

Encumbrances

Claims or liens on a property that may affect transfer, including mortgages, easements, or tax liens.

Deed

A legal document that conveys ownership from seller to buyer, recorded to provide public notice of transfer.

Escrow and Closing

A neutral holder of funds and documents that helps complete the sale and ensures conditions are met before transfer.

What is Retail Office Industrial Property Sales?

A Retail Office Industrial Property Sales involves the orderly transfer of ownership for commercial spaces used for retail, offices, and industrial operations. The process includes negotiations, due diligence, title review, and coordination with lenders and escrow teams.

While not always required, having a qualified real estate attorney can help ensure contract terms protect your interests, identify risks early, and navigate California’s regulatory requirements efficiently.

Typical closing documents include purchase agreements or deeds, title reports, disclosures, loan documents, and any affidavits or permits necessary for the transaction.

Transaction timelines vary by complexity, but a straightforward sale or purchase may take several weeks to a few months, depending on financing, title issues, and regulatory approvals.

Common title issues include unresolved liens, conflicting ownership history, boundary disputes, or clouded title; these are usually addressed during due diligence and title cure processes.

Escrow provides a neutral holding place for funds and documents while conditions are met, helping ensure a secure and orderly transfer of ownership.

Many disputes can be resolved through negotiation, mediation, or arbitration; litigation is typically a last resort when other options fail.

Transaction costs may include title, escrow, recording fees, and professional services; you should discuss all anticipated costs with your attorney and lender.

Zoning and permits affect what a property can be used for and may require additional approvals or variance requests before closing.
